摘要
The DPPH radical scavenging activity of two flavonol glycosides obtained from ethanolic extracts of Aconitum napellus sp. lusitanicurn was studied. The results showed a high DPPH antiradical activity of compound 1 (quercetin 3-O-(6-transcaffeoyl)-beta-glucopyranosyl-(1 -> 2)-beta-glucopyranosyl-7-O-alpha-rhamnopyranoside) when compared with compound 2 (quercetin-3-sophoroside-7-rhamnopyranoside), rutin and ascorbic acid. The relationship between the caffeoyl and rhamnopyranoside groups in the flavonol glycosides structures and the DPPH antiradical activity was also discussed. (c) 2006 Elsevier B.V.
